## Formula sandbox tuning

User-supplied formulas in Gridmoor execute inside a restricted interpreter with hard ceilings on time, memory, and call depth. Reviewers should confirm any change to these ceilings is justified in the PR description, since raising them widens the abuse surface. Defaults were chosen from production traces. The current limits are as follows.

limits module of tafog-fawip:
WEIGHTS = {
    "julix": 57,
    "lamys": 992,
    "kasvan": 209,
    "quenok": 750,
    "alddor": 259,
    "oliath": 1009,
    "wenix": 815,
}

Subject: Reception desk relocating to ground floor

Hi all,

From Monday, the Oakhaven Analytics reception desk moves from level 2 to the ground-floor atrium. Visitor sign-in, courier drop-offs, and lost property all move with it. The old level 2 counter will be closed off. To unlock the new desk's storage cupboard, use this pass code:

staff pass of kagup-fajog = bdg-QCHVQW-99665837

Finance Review Summary — Legacy Pricing

Finance team: Legacy customers on the Merrow plan remain 18% below current rates. We will raise legacy pricing 12% at renewal, phased over two cycles. Expected annualised uplift: modest churn assumed at 4%. Kessler-Vane accounts are exempt pending review. Rationale and timing considerations appear in the confidential note below.

management briefing: Project Ulavan slips by two quarters because of the staffing delay.

## Changelog — Font vendoring defaults changed

As of this release, the Bracken UI build no longer fetches third-party fonts at build time. All typefaces used by the Lanternwell suite are now vendored into the repo under a dedicated assets directory, and the fetch step is skipped by default. If you're onboarding, nothing to install — the fonts travel with the checkout. The build flags controlling this behavior are listed below.

settings of hadup-yafog:
LAMAEL_PIN=3761
LAMAEL_TENANT=istmir
LAMAEL_METRICS_HOST=metrics.lamael.plorvasys.test
LAMAEL_SEAL=seal_8ea68500
LAMAEL_STANDBY_TEAM=fraok